The magnetic resonance phase-contrast technique for the measurement of flow velocity and volume in true and false lumens was studied in six patients with chronic dissecting aneurysms. Phase-contrast images were obtained at a level perpendicular to the dissecting aneurysms of the descending aorta. As the maximum diameter of aneurysms increased, the ratio of the cross-sectional area of the false to the true lumen increased and the peak average velocity in the true lumen during systole was decreased. This technique proved invaluable for determining prognosis and operability for this condition.  相似文献

An 8-month-old boy had an anterior type of persistent hyperplastic primary vitreous in the right eye. Results of needle biopsy, performed because of elevated intraocular pressure, disclosed clusters of blastic cells. The eye was enucleated on the suspicion of retinoblastoma. Histological examination showed retrolental fibrovascular tissue and retinal dysplasia. Immunoreactive opsin was detected in the innermost structures and in photoreceptor-like cells of rosettes. We conclude that photoreceptor cells differentiated to express opsin, even when neighbouring cells were abnormally arranged. An immunocytochemical study of glial fibrillary acidic protein demonstrated glial proliferation in the inner layer of the retina but not in the preretinal space.  相似文献

To evaluate the effect of smoking on nonrespiratory function in the lung, a dynamic PET with 13NH3 in the lung was performed in 18 normal volunteers without lung disease nor congestion (9 non-smokers, 4 exsmokers, 5 smokers). After intravenous bolus injection of 13NH3, twenty serial 5.5-second scans followed by six 30-second scans were performed. Regions of interests were assigned on the ventral, lateral and dorsal part of the right lung and time-activity curves were generated through 26 images. The activity curve demonstrated a biexponential clearance from the lung with fast and slow component. The retention fraction (RF), fractional size of the slow component, was calculated, and the half-times (t 1/2) of both components were also evaluated. A significant increase of RF and prolongation of t 1/2 of slow component were observed in smokers compared to non-smokers and exsmokers. However, no significant difference of RF nor t 1/2 of both components was observed between non-smokers and exsmokers. These results suggest that long term smoking may modify the pulmonary kinetics of 13NH3, but the change is reversible after cessation of smoking for one year or longer.  相似文献

Summary: Follicular dendritic cells (FDC) are found in the follicles of virtually all secondary lymphoid tissues. In health, these cells trap and retain antigens (Ag) in the form of immune complexes and preserve them for months in their native conformation. FDC thus serve as a long-term repository of extracellular Ag important for induction and maintenance of memory responses. In retroviral infection. FDC trap and retain large numbers of retroviral particles with profound effects on FDC. FDC-trapped retrovirus induces follicular hyperplasia, and conventional Ag trapped prior to infection are lost and new Ag cannot be trapped. Concomitantly, antibody-forming cells (AFC) specific for Ag lost from FDC decrease follow I by loss of specific serum antibody (Ab). Eventually, FDC die and follicular lysis occurs. From the pathogen perspective, binding to FDC is remarkably beneficial, bringing together virus and activated target cells that are highly susceptible to infection. Furthermore, FDC permit HIV to infect surrounding cells even in the presence of a vast excess of neutralizing Ab. Preliminary data suggest that FDC maintain virus infectivity - even when the virus cannot replicate. Thus retrovirus infection monopolizes FDC networks, thereby transforming the FDC Ag repository into a highly infectious retroviral reservoir.  相似文献

The bimodal molecular weight distribution (MWD) of the polymers and the polymerization rate in the cationic polymerization of styrene by CF3SO3H were studied under a variety of conditions. Both the decrease of the dielectric constant of the reaction mixture and the addition of a common-ion salt (Bu4N+SO3CF) reduced the polymerization rate and the formation of the higher molecular weight portion of the polymers (the high polymer). It appears that of the two propagating species the one which forms the high polymer is more ionically dissociated and more reactive in propagation. Salt effects indicate that in nitrobenzene the propagating species is a solvent-separated ion pair and/or a free ion. The effects of monomer concentration on the bimodal MWD have shown that there are different chain-breaking reactions for the two propagating species. The possibility that the monomer is complexed with one of the growing species is also discussed.  相似文献

Block copolymerizations of 1-chloro-1-octyne (1-ClO) with several substituted acetylenes were examined by means of living polymerization. o-(Trifluoromethyl)phenylacetylene (o-CF3PA), o-(trimethylsilyl)phenylacetylene (o-Me3SiPA), 1-chloro-2-phenylacetylene (1-ClPA), p-butyl-o,o,m,m-tetrafluorophenylacetylene (p-BuF4PA), and tert-butylacetylene (t-BuA) were used as comonomers, and the MoOCl4-n-Bu4Sn-EtOH (mole ratio 1:1:1) catalyst, which is known to effect living polymerization of substituted acetylenes, was employed. When o-CF3PA and 1-CIPA were the comonomers in combination with 1-CIO, block copolymers were exclusively obtained in both orders of monomer addition. In the cases of o-Me3SiPA and p-BuF4PA as comonomers, the copolymerizations initiated from 1-CIO produced block copolymers selectively, whereas the homopolymers of o-Me3SiPA and p-BuF4PA also formed if the order of monomer addition was reversed. The pair of 1-CIO and t-BuA did not selectively yield block copolymers irrespective of the order of monomer addition. Thus, block copolymerization occurred between 1-CIO and monomers that show high “livingness” and close reactivities.  相似文献
